Which companies sponsor visas for inside sales representatives in Massachusetts?
Technology and life sciences companies in Massachusetts are the most active sponsors for inside sales roles. Employers like HubSpot, Salesforce, Rapid7, and Dynatrace have sponsored H-1B visa workers in sales-adjacent positions. Enterprise software, cybersecurity, and SaaS firms headquartered in Boston and the Route 128 corridor tend to have immigration programs already in place, which makes sponsorship more straightforward for qualifying candidates.
Which visa types are most common for inside sales representative roles in Massachusetts?
The H-1B is the most common visa for inside sales representatives in Massachusetts, though it requires the role to qualify as a specialty occupation, meaning a bachelor's degree in a relevant field must be a genuine requirement of the position. Some candidates also enter through the L-1 visa intracompany transferee visa when relocating from a foreign affiliate of a U.S. employer. O-1 visas are occasionally applicable for candidates with documented exceptional achievement in sales or business development.

Are there state-specific factors that affect visa sponsorship for inside sales roles in Massachusetts?
Massachusetts is home to several top universities, including MIT, Harvard, Northeastern, and Boston University, which create a steady pipeline of OPT-eligible international graduates who often transition into inside sales roles at local tech and life sciences firms. Employers in Massachusetts are generally familiar with work visa processes given the state's high concentration of international talent. Prevailing wage requirements under the H-1B program apply statewide, and roles must genuinely require a specialized degree to qualify.
What is the prevailing wage for sponsored inside sales representative jobs in Massachusetts?
U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
